![]() Personally, unless for some reason it's impossible. I would always go for EFi
I converted our MK1 golf from carb to EFI. There's not actually that many sensors and most of them are designed to last a very long time. I would find some spare injectors on ebay , perhaps have them cleaned too. There are no real advantages to a carb over a EFI system especialy if you retro fitting it to a car that was never supplied with a carb. TT
